The Foreign Minister of Iran says that Hassan Kazemi Qomi, the ambassador of Iran in Kabul has discussed with the authorities of the Islamic Emirate about the water rights of the Helmand Sea.
Amir Abdollahian, speaking to Sada and Sima network, said that these negotiations had good results.
Meanwhile, referring to clashes between the two country’s border forces, Abdollahian emphasized that Iran understands the situation in Afghanistan and the Afghan authorities stated that these clashes were not targeted.
Tensions between Afghanistan and Iran over the water right of the Helmand Sea increased after the harsh statements of the Iranian president.
He threatened that Afghanistan will take Iran’s claim to the Helmand Sea seriously and provide it.
Simultaneously with these tensions, the border forces of Iran and the Islamic Emirate clashed in Nimroz province last Saturday, in which two Iranian soldiers were killed.
